Course Goal / Objective

Students will able to learn tourism industry, dimensions and effects of the tourism.

Course Content

Explaining economic concepts and distinguishing between micro economics and macro economics. Analyzing macro and micro aspects of domestic-international tourism with their impact on national economies and tourism sector.

Course Learning Outcomes

Order Course Learning Outcomes
LO01 Defines the concepts of tourism-related supply, demand, need, market and so on.,learns economic impact of tourism, and the real economic impact of tourism, learns employment and employment impact of tourism
LO02 Having knowledge about Tourism Supply
LO03 Having knowledge about tourism demand
LO04 Being knowledgeable about the markets and the firm balance in tourism sector
LO05 To learn tourism development and economic outcomes
LO06 To learn about tourism national economic effects
LO07 To learn the Balance Effects of Tourism External Payments
LO08 To learn the effects of tourism on income, price and expenditures
